Get PriceThe reclaim process starts with a refined wafer inspection presorting wafers by type thickness and resistivity Each wafer is then lapped and/or etched to remove patterns scratches and other surface defects resulting in is a clean high quality wafer ready for polishing Once a wafer is finished polishing it gets a final cleaning

Get PriceFirst wafers go through the oxidation process Oxygen or water vapor is sprayed on the wafer surface to form a uniform oxide film This oxide film protects the wafer surface during the subsequent processes and also blocks current leakage between circuits The film acts as a strong protective shield Now the foundation for semiconductor is ready

Get PriceProcess flow diagram for the production of semiconductor grade electronic grade silicon Single Crystal Silicon Wafer Fabrication The silicon wafers so familiar to those of us in the semiconductor industry are actually thin slices of a large single crystal of silicon that was grown from melted electronic grade polycrystalline silicon

Get PriceBut in some cases companies perform wafer sort to monitor the silicon foundry yield This feedback is then feedbacked to the fab to further optimize the silicon manufacturing process and hence improve the process yield A digital wafer map is attached to each wafer that has been tested to label the passing and non passing dies
